Now, let's make with pumpkin. Here is the recipe.

What do you need?

Pumpkin: 3 cups

Sugar: 1 cup

Ghee: 1 tablespoon

Milk: 1 cup

Salt: a pinch

Condensed milk: 1 cup

Small cardamom powder: half a teaspoon

Cashews: 2 tablespoons

Pistachios: 2 tablespoons

Almonds: 2 tablespoons

Saffron: a pinch

How to make it?

First, peel the pumpkin, wash it well, and grate it. Then heat ghee in a pan and fry all types of chopped nuts. Now add the grated pumpkin. Fry that grated pumpkin with a pinch of salt for five minutes and cover the pan.

When the pumpkin is cooked, add milk and sugar. If the milk becomes thick, you can add a little water. Keep stirring until the pumpkin is completely cooked. Now add the condensed milk and mix everything well. Before serving, sprinkle some cardamom powder and roasted nuts and you're done. It will also look nice if you sprinkle saffron on top before serving.

Halwa is not suggested to eat hot. Keep it in the refrigerator and serve it cold to friends and relatives.
